Aspergillus fumigatus endocarditis is one of the rarest and severest complications in cardiological patients. We describe a patient with an intracardial pacemaker who was diagnosed as having Aspergillus fumigatus endocarditis. Postmortem examination showed a large, Aspergillus-infected thrombus encased in the right ventricle, pulmonary trunk and main pulmonary branches.

Invasive pulmonary aspergillosis is typically caused by a single Aspergillus species, most frequently Aspergillus fumigatus. Here we report that a lung transplant recipient developed invasive aspergillosis due to a mixed infection caused by Aspergillus flavus and A. fumigatus. The implications for this unusual finding are discussed.
